What Should a Teacher Actually Ask AI to Do?

Prep and assessment work a teacher does before and after class, not work a student submits as their own. That line matters enough to state clearly before naming a single tool below.

Legitimate use, the kind this page covers: drafting a lesson plan against a standard, building a rubric that matches that lesson's objectives, adjusting a text's reading level for one student without rewriting the whole class's material, drafting parent-communication language, and turning feedback notes into full comments faster. Every one of those tasks starts from something a teacher already knows: the standard, the class, the student's actual needs. AI is doing the drafting, not the deciding.

Not covered, and not what any prompt below is built for: having AI write an essay, a lab report or an assignment that a student then hands in under their own name. That distinction holds regardless of which tool produces the text, a general chat model, a classroom platform, or a prompt manager like ours; the question is never which tool, it's whose name goes on the finished work.

Most institutions already have a policy distinguishing AI-assisted preparation by staff from AI-generated submissions by students. Read your own school's actual policy rather than assuming either way, and disclose AI use where a policy asks you to.

The useful test is who submits the output, and under whose name. A rubric you write with AI assistance and then apply to grade a class is your own professional work product, the same as a rubric you wrote entirely by hand. An essay a student generates and hands in as their own writing is a different act altogether, regardless of which tool produced it. This page is built for the first case.

Brisk Teaching is a browser extension, and its own site lists over 30 tools by name, including a quiz generator, a presentation maker, a rubric generator, batch feedback, and a lesson plan generator, meaning it covers the whole prep-through-assessment chain this page is organized around, inside one extension rather than a separate web platform. Its own site also organizes tools by subject (English, Math, Science, Elementary, Special education and ELL) and by platform (Google or Microsoft), and lists a newer "Brisk Intelligence" feature described as AI that already knows a school's curriculum, aimed at cutting down on re-explaining the same curriculum context in every prompt.

MagicSchool is explicitly a district-level platform, with distinct tracks for superintendents, principals, teachers and students. Its "For Teachers" section states its aim as helping teachers "Save time, spark creativity, and support every learner". Its broader positioning leans on privacy and security features aimed at schools adopting AI at a district scale, its own site names protecting privacy and security, and building AI literacy, as explicit selling points, not on a single teacher's individual workflow. That framing makes sense for an administrator deciding what to roll out district-wide; it's a heavier evaluation than an individual teacher picking a tool for their own classroom needs.

Diffit does one job and names it directly: its own site states "We help teachers do their best work" through creating "print-ready lessons your students will love". Its whole product is built around taking an existing text and adjusting it for different reading levels and needs. If your problem is specifically differentiation, not lesson planning from scratch, Diffit is narrower and more specific than an all-in-one platform, and that narrowness is a legitimate reason to pick it over a broader suite that treats differentiation as one feature among thirty.

SchoolAI centers on a feature called Spaces: AI-guided activities a teacher builds and assigns, with students working through them directly while the teacher monitors. Its own site frames this as "AI that connects teachers with every student". Its published testimonials describe teachers using it to track differentiation and engagement across a class rather than to draft lesson content for themselves, and its own navigation lists a dedicated Trust and Safety section alongside its product pages, which is worth checking directly if a tool talking to students, rather than only to the teacher, is a meaningful distinction for your school's policy.

Khanmigo, Khan Academy's AI assistant, offers a distinct teacher track alongside its learner-facing tutor, described on its own site as helping teachers "Knock something off your to-do list in minutes". It states plainly that it is "Built for educators by educators, with your needs in mind." It reads less like a template generator and more like a task-by-task assistant a teacher talks to directly, and its own site also lists a separate Writing Coach product alongside Khanmigo itself, aimed specifically at writing practice and instruction rather than general lesson prep.

Curipod is worth a mention with an honest caveat: its current site is titled "Writing Practice Students Love". Its own home page leads with student outcome data rather than teacher-facing tooling. It remains teacher-led, a teacher builds and runs the lesson, but its current marketing centers the student experience more than the other five tools here, so it's a different fit if what you want is a teacher-facing prep tool rather than a guided classroom activity.

How Does a Lesson Plan, Rubric and Differentiation Chain Actually Work?

The version worth building yourself, in ChatGPT, Claude or a prompt manager, when you want the rubric to match the lesson's actual objectives and the differentiated version to match the same rubric, rather than three separately-generated documents that drift apart.

Start with one block of context, reused across all three prompts so the standard, grade level and class section stay identical throughout:

# LESSON CONTEXT BLOCK - fill in once, reuse in every prompt below

Grade level: [GRADE]
Subject and unit: [SUBJECT / UNIT]
Standard being taught: [STANDARD, e.g. a specific state or Common Core code]
Class section: [PERIOD/SECTION - useful when you teach the same lesson more than once]
Time available: [MINUTES]

The lesson plan, generated first:

[PASTE LESSON CONTEXT BLOCK]

Task: draft a lesson plan for this class period.

Include: a one-sentence learning objective tied directly to the standard
above, a warm-up (5 minutes), the main activity, a formative check for
understanding, and a closing task. State the objective in language a
rubric could be built from directly, not just a topic description.

The rubric, built from the approved lesson plan so the assessment actually matches what was taught, not a generic template:

[PASTE LESSON CONTEXT BLOCK]
[PASTE APPROVED LESSON PLAN]

Task: write a 4-level rubric (Beginning, Developing, Proficient, Advanced)
for the closing task in this lesson plan.

Every criterion must trace back to the stated learning objective. Do not
add a criterion that wasn't part of what this lesson actually taught.
Output as a table: criterion, then one row per level with concrete,
observable language, not vague terms like "shows understanding."

The differentiated version, for one student or a whole section that needs it, reusing the same lesson and rubric so the differentiated version is still assessed on the same standard:

[PASTE LESSON CONTEXT BLOCK]
[PASTE APPROVED LESSON PLAN]

Task: adapt this lesson's main activity and closing task for a student who
needs: [SPECIFIC NEED - e.g. a lower independent reading level, an ELL
student building academic vocabulary, or a student needing more scaffolding
on a specific step].

Keep the same learning objective and the same rubric from above unchanged.
Change only the reading level, the scaffolding, and the format of the
task itself. State explicitly what you changed and why, in one line, so
it's easy to review before using it.

Reusing the same context and the same approved lesson plan across all three prompts is what keeps the rubric matched to what was actually taught, and the differentiated version assessed against the identical standard rather than a quietly easier one.

The same context block extends naturally to the parent-communication task named earlier, reusing the approved rubric so a grade explanation actually matches the criteria a parent could ask to see:

[PASTE LESSON CONTEXT BLOCK]
[PASTE THE RUBRIC]

Task: draft a short note home explaining how [STUDENT FIRST NAME, or "a
student"] did on this assessment, based on: [WHICH RUBRIC LEVEL THEY HIT
ON EACH CRITERION].

Write two to four sentences. Name one concrete strength tied to a specific
criterion, one concrete area to work on tied to a specific criterion, and
end with one thing the parent can do at home this week. Plain language, no
rubric jargon a parent wouldn't recognize from a report card.

Four documents, one context block, one standard, one rubric: the lesson plan, the assessment, the differentiated version, and the note home all trace back to the same objective instead of drifting into four separate descriptions of what the class actually covered.

Which of These Five Tools Should You Actually Start With?

It depends on which part of the chain above is actually costing you the most time right now, which is rarely the same answer for two different teachers.

If lesson planning itself is the bottleneck, start with Brisk Teaching or MagicSchool: both generate a full lesson plan directly, and Brisk's extension-based approach means it works inside whatever site or document you're already using, rather than requiring a separate platform tab. MagicSchool is the better fit if your school or district is evaluating a platform for everyone, not just for you.

If your students span a wide range of reading levels in one class, Diffit is worth trying before a broader suite, precisely because it does one job and does it as its whole product rather than as one feature among many.

If you want students working directly with a guided AI activity rather than reading something you generated for them, SchoolAI's Spaces or Khanmigo are built for that, not for generating a lesson plan for you to deliver yourself.

If none of the above and you're using ChatGPT, Claude or Gemini directly already, the chain of prompts earlier on this page, and a saved context block to run them from, gets you most of the way to what a dedicated platform automates, at the cost of more manual copy-pasting between steps.

Why Not Just Use an AI Detector to Check Student Work?

Because the tools that claim to do this reliably do not, and the people they get wrong most often are exactly the students least able to defend themselves against the accusation.

A 2023 Stanford study evaluated several widely-used GPT detectors against writing samples from both native and non-native English speakers. Its own abstract states the finding directly: the detectors "consistently misclassify non-native English writing samples as AI-generated, whereas native writing samples are accurately identified." The same study found that simple prompting strategies could both reduce that bias and separately bypass the detectors entirely, and its authors conclude by cautioning "against their use in evaluative or educational settings, particularly when they may inadvertently penalize or exclude non-native English speakers from the global discourse."

That is not a claim about one bad detector; it is a documented pattern across the category, from a paper the detector vendors themselves have had two years to answer. This page does not name or recommend an AI-detection product, for any student population, and treats a false accusation as a materially worse outcome than an undetected case of AI-assisted writing. If a school policy requires using one anyway, know going in what the research actually found, and weigh a flagged result accordingly rather than treating a detector's score as settled fact.

If verifying a student's own understanding matters more than a probabilistic AI-detection score, in-class writing, a short oral defense of a submitted piece, or comparing a final draft against earlier drafts or notes are process-based checks that don't carry the same bias risk. None of that is a claim we're positioned to make in detail; it's a direction to look, not a policy to adopt from a blog post.

It's also worth naming the incentive at play, since it rarely gets said plainly. A detector vendor's product only has a reason to exist if it reports a confident yes-or-no answer, and a tool built to always answer with uncertainty wouldn't sell. That commercial pressure toward false confidence is a separate problem from the specific non-native-writer bias the Stanford study measured, and it's a reason for genuine skepticism even in cases where no dedicated bias study exists yet for one particular detector product.
